RE: [QuadtoneRIP] Densitometer reading input - was: New UT7 curves available

2005-08-28 by Daniel Staver

I tried both X-Key and ToolCrib today. ToolCrib also contains X-Key but that
version appears to lack the ability to transform carriage returns into tabs,
which makes it useless for entering data into QTRgui. It's almost as quick
to just capture the data into a text file and paste into QTRgui though.

> The Mac version of x-key seems to have disappeared. Given the 
> ancient vintage of the PC version, the Mac version was likely 
> for OS9. As an alternative you could download the Mac version 
> of ToolCrib from x-rite, available through this link:
> 
> http://www.xrite.com/support_doc.aspx?Lang=en&SoftwareID=196
> 
> The so-called Generic device provides the x-key functions and 
> supports the older densitometers with serial interfaces such 
> as the 810.
